Natural durability of wood and wood-based material and efficiency of protection systems

Last update: 8 March 2024

Tests and expert appraisals in all fields relating to the durability and protection of wood and wood-based materials, anti-termite protection systems (barriers), and associated aging.

Our wood preservation laboratory carries out tests to assess the durability of wood and wood-based materials, as well as the effectivenes of wood preservatives and various protection methods (heat treatment, chemical modification, etc.). These tests can include associated aging processes (leaching, evaporation, natural aging). Our tests also extend to the effectiveness of products intended for use as anti-termite barriers and their associated ageing, in the laboratory or on natural sites.

Test according to standard EN 73 (2020)

Durability of wood and wood-based products - Accelerated ageing of treated wood prior to biological testing - Evaporative ageing procedure

Test according to standard EN 84 (2020)

Durability of wood and wood-based products - Accelerated ageing of treated wood prior to biological testing - Leaching procedure

Test according to standard EN 113-1 (2020)

Durability of wood and wood-based products - Test method against wood destroying basidiomycetes - Part 1: Assessment of biocidal efficacy of wood preservatives

Test according to standard EN 113-2 (2020)

Durability of wood and wood-based products - Test method against wood destroying basidiomycetes - Part 2: Assessment of inherent or enhanced durability

Test according to standard EN 113-3 (2023)

Durability of wood and wood-based products - Test method against wood destroying basidiomycetes - Part 3: Assessment of durability of wood-based panels

Test according to standard EN 117 (2013)

Wood preservatives - Determination of toxic values against Reticulitermes species (European termites) (Laboratory method)

Test according to standard EN 118 (2014)

Wood preservatives - Determination of preventive action against Reticulitermes species (European termites) (Laboratory method)

Test according to standard XP X 41-542 (1995)

Wood preservatives - Anti-termite treatment product for floors, walls, foundations and masonry work - Accelerated ageing test of treated materials prior to biological testing - Percolation test

Test according to standard XP X 41-550 (2009)

Termites - Determination of the effectiveness against termites of products or material used as barrrier designed for ground and/or wall - Laboratory method

Other tests

We also carry out other tests on the durability and efficacy of protective products and methods, using adapted equipment and various laboratory procedures. Specific tests can also be carried out, on request, in humid tropical environments. These mainly concern wood protection against wood-destroying fungi and insects and marine borers.
